Chat over ChaiChat over Chai is an informal, informative and independent committee led Community group for adults (18+) which aims to support physical, mental and emotional well-being whilst reducing social isolation.
We are a welcoming, friendly and diverse group who come together weekly on Thursdays for a stimulating programme of talks, courses and events, enhancing our learning in many subject areas and increasing our knowledge of facilities and services available in the City of Portsmouth and local area. Regular session times Thursdays 12.30 – 2.30 Thursdays, no need to book, just drop in. Suggested voluntary contribution £1.00 per session 324 Fawcett Road

Children's drawing workshop at North End libraryAimed at children aged 7-16 this session is for youngsters interested in improving their drawing skills. Local artist Andy White will show you how to how to draw with pencils, pens or felt tips. He will teach different methods and help you come up with new ideas. Suitable for beginners or the more advanced. Materials will be provided but you can bring your own if you wish – Andy will show you how to get the best out of them. Choice Care Downham LodgeDownham Lodge is an eight-bedroom residential home for men and women with mental health conditions. Current residents range in age from 19 to 59. The home can support a wide spectrum of conditions, including personality disorder, schizophrenia and acquired brain injury.
